Shirley Ann Foley was born in 1920 in Newark, Licking, Ohio, USA, the child of Judson Taylor Lewis Md And Mary Elizabeth Kear. In 1939, Shirley Ann Foley resided in Newark. In 1941, Shirley Ann Foley resided in Newark, Ohio, USA. Shirley Ann Foley married Lewis, Neal Preston Inscho Sr, and had children including Neal Preston Inscho Jr, Stephen Lewis Inscho. Shirley Ann Foley passed away in 2000 in Newark, Licking, Ohio, USA.
